IND vs ENG: What to expect in Hyderabad?

The pitch at Rajiv Gandhi International Stadium is batting-friendly. Although most pitches in recent times in India favor spinners, the surface in Hyderabad allows batters to score big runs.

Despite batters being the dominant force in Hyderabad, bowlers are never out of the game here. In the last match played here, batters and bowlers remained equal throughout the match.

Both teams scored more than 300 runs in their first innings, and pacers and spinners both did as well. The fast bowlers had the upper hand, taking 18 of the 30 wickets in the match, and spinners took the remaining 12.

The average first-inning score here is 405, illustrating that the best time to bat here is in the first inning. Chasing in the fourth inning here is extremely difficult. Out of the five matches played here, only once has a team completed a successful chase. That, too, was a mere 72-run target in the fourth inning.
